/* These functions are hidden in NEXTSTEP, but beacuse they have syscall()
** entries I can wrap these into their corresponding missing function.
*/
caddr_t
mmap(caddr_t addr, size_t len, int prot, int flags,
int fildes, off_t off)
{
return (caddr_t) syscall (SYS_mmap, addr, len, prot, flags, fildes, off);
}
int
munmap(caddr_t addr, size_t len)
{
return syscall (SYS_munmap, addr, len);
}
int
mprotect(caddr_t addr, size_t len, int prot)
{
return syscall (SYS_mprotect, addr, len, prot);
}

/* These are my mach based versions, untested and probably bad ...
*/
caddr_t my_mmap(caddr_t addr, size_t len, int prot, int flags,
int fildes, off_t off)
{
kern_return_t ret_val;
/* First map ...
*/
ret_val = map_fd ( fildes, /* fd */
(vm_offset_t) off, /* offset */
(vm_offset_t*)&addr, /* address */
TRUE, /* find_space */
(vm_size_t) len); /* size */
if (ret_val != KERN_SUCCESS) {
mach_error("Error calling map_fd() in mmap", ret_val );
return (caddr_t)0;
}
/* ... then protect (this is probably bad)
*/
ret_val = vm_protect( task_self(), /* target_task */
(vm_address_t)addr, /* address */
(vm_size_t) len, /* size */
FALSE, /* set_maximum */
(vm_prot_t) prot); /* new_protection */
if (ret_val != KERN_SUCCESS) {
mach_error("vm_protect in mmap()", ret_val );
return (caddr_t)0;
}
return addr;
}
int my_munmap(caddr_t addr, size_t len)
{
kern_return_t ret_val;
ret_val = vm_deallocate(task_self(),
(vm_address_t) addr,
(vm_size_t) len);
if (ret_val != KERN_SUCCESS) {
mach_error("vm_deallocate in munmap()", ret_val);
return -1;
}
return 0;
}
int my_mprotect(caddr_t addr, size_t len, int prot)
{
vm_prot_t mach_prot;
kern_return_t ret_val;
switch (prot) {
case PROT_READ: mach_prot = VM_PROT_READ; break;
case PROT_WRITE: mach_prot = VM_PROT_WRITE; break;
case PROT_EXEC: mach_prot = VM_PROT_EXECUTE; break;
case PROT_NONE: mach_prot = VM_PROT_NONE; break;
}
ret_val = vm_protect(task_self(), /* target_task */
(vm_address_t)addr, /* address */
(vm_size_t) len, /* size */
FALSE, /* set_maximum */
(vm_prot_t) prot); /* new_protection */
if (ret_val != KERN_SUCCESS) {
mach_error("vm_protect in mprotect()", ret_val);
return -1;
}
return 0;
}
